摘要
土壤导热系数的大小直接对土壤源热泵系统中埋地换热器的面积和初投资有显著影响。现场测试法是研究土壤热物性参数最有效的方法之一,结合邢台市沙河收费站地源热泵测试工程实例,介绍了地源热泵热响应测试的测试步骤、测试方法和数据分析。实测结果与传统查手册的结果相比更为准确可靠,为当地地源热泵系统的准确设计提供了依据。
The ground heat exchanger size and cost are directly dependent on the ground thermal conductivity.Field test method is the most effective way to study the soil thermal properties.This paper introduces the ground source heat pump thermal response test of testing procedures,test methods and data analysis,combined with Xingtai shahe toll station ground source heat pump test engineering example.The measured results compared with the traditional manual inspection results,measured results are more accurate and reliable.It is provided for the local ground source heat pump system for theoretical basis.
